Consultations begin life as 'open', move to 'closed' when the expiry date passes and finally become 'concluded' when the final response document is published.

Best practice for consultations

  • Never use the word 'consultation' in the page title and summary because that's the content type which will display with the title and summary
  • Use active voice for summary - 'we're inviting feedback on' or 'we're seeking views on' to invite responses 
  • Never change the summary and description text through the process - add new text to the relevant tabs instead
  • Tick the Consultation principles box in Whitehall which says 'We have considered the consultation principles' or you won't be able to save the page
